一台云服务器可以供几个数据库?

一台云服务器能承载多少数据库:容量与负载的考量

在云计算时代,云服务器因其弹性和灵活性成为了企业部署数据库的首选平台。然而,一个常见的问题便是:一台云服务器究竟能容纳多少数据库?这个问题的答案并非一成不变,它取决于多个关键因素。这里将首先给出结论,然后深入探讨影响这一决策的主要因素。

结论:一台云服务器能承载的数据库数量并非固定,而是根据服务器配置、数据库类型、数据大小、并发访问量以及性能需求等因素综合决定。一般来说,高端云服务器可以支持上百个小型或中型数据库,而大型复杂应用可能需要多台服务器进行分布式部署。

一、服务器配置
服务器的CPU核心数、内存大小和存储空间直接影响了它能承载的数据库数量。更强大的硬件配置意味着更大的处理能力和存储容量,能同时处理更多的数据库实例。例如,一台拥有32核CPU、256GB内存的服务器相比只有一核一内存的服务器,理论上能支持更多数据库。

二、数据库类型
不同的数据库系统有不同的资源消耗。关系型数据库如MySQL、PostgreSQL等相对轻量级,而NoSQL数据库如MongoDB、Cassandra则可能更占用资源。因此,选择适合的数据库类型对承载能力有直接影响。

三、数据大小和并发访问量
数据库的大小和用户并发访问量也会影响服务器的负载。如果数据库数据量大,频繁的读写操作可能会占用更多资源。同时,高并发访问可能导致服务器压力增大。因此,合理规划数据库设计和优化查询性能是关键。

四、性能需求
对于一些高性能、高并发的应用,可能需要使用数据库集群或者数据库分片技术,以分散负载。在这种情况下,一台服务器可能不足以满足需求,需要多台服务器协同工作。

五、扩展性
云服务通常提供水平扩展的能力,即通过增加服务器数量来提高数据库的承载能力。当单台服务器无法满足需求时,可以根据业务增长情况动态调整资源。

综上所述,一台云服务器能承载的数据库数量并非固定的,而是需要根据实际业务需求和技术选型来灵活调整。在规划时,务必充分考虑服务器配置、数据库类型、数据规模、并发访问量以及未来的扩展需求,确保系统的稳定性和性能。

未经允许不得转载:秒懂云 » 一台云服务器可以供几个数据库?